I’ve been in that there stretch of Colorado and would say if you’ve got the points to draw that tag I think you’d have a great time.
 
Colo antelope numbers are down considerably from 15+ years ago to today. Tag quotas have been cut and have remained low. There are very few b&c bucks that come from Colo and even fewer the past 15 years. I’ve been sitting on a pile of pts for years and don’t get excited about Colo antelope.

As mentioned you’ll have a great time but your work is cut out for you if score is important
